Display device subpixel activation patterns

    公开(公告)号:US10593278B2

    公开(公告)日:2020-03-17

    申请号:US15822906

    申请日:2017-11-27

    Abstract: A display device includes a data driver, a multiplexer, and a multiplexer controller. The data driver outputs a data voltage through output buffers. The multiplexer distributes each of the data voltages output by the output buffers to data lines in a time division manner in response to first to control signals. The multiplexer controller sequentially outputs control signals in a time division manner. Each control signal transitions to a gate ON voltage during a prior horizontal period and maintains the gate ON voltage for an intended horizontal period.

    METHOD FOR REPAIRING AND INSPECTING DISPLAY DEVICE

    公开(公告)号:US20240258454A1

    公开(公告)日:2024-08-01

    申请号:US18221563

    申请日:2023-07-13

    CPC classification number: H01L33/0095 H01L27/156

    Abstract: A method for repairing and inspecting a display device include transferring a light-emitting element onto the panel substrate; positioning the inspection substrate on the panel substrate such that the contact pins of the inspection substrate face the light-emitting element; connecting the contact pins to the light-emitting element and applying a voltage to the contact pins to identify whether or not the light-emitting element emits light and thus is defective or normal; upon determination that the light-emitting element is defective, replacing the defective light-emitting element with a normal light-emitting element; and connecting a wiring electrode to the normal light-emitting element.

    DISPLAY DEVICE SUBPIXEL ACTIVATION PATTERNS
    3.
    发明申请

    公开(公告)号:US20180151145A1

    公开(公告)日:2018-05-31

    申请号:US15822591

    申请日:2017-11-27

    Abstract: A display device includes a display panel, a data driver, a multiplexer, and a multiplexer controller. First to fourth color subpixels are disposed on the display panel. The data driver outputs a data voltage to be supplied to the first to fourth color subpixels, through output buffers. The multiplexer distributes each of data voltages output by output buffers to four data lines in a time division manner in response to first to fourth control signals. The multiplexer controller sequentially outputs a first control signal to an nth control signal during a first horizontal period, and sequentially outputs the nth control signal to the first control signal during a second horizontal period. The first and second horizontal periods include first to fourth scan periods which are continuous and uniform, and a subpixel receiving a data voltage output during the first scan period of the first horizontal period and a subpixel receiving a data voltage output during the first scan period of the second horizontal period are subpixels of the same color.
